How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Newburgh?

Newburgh Apartments
Bed Type Average Rent Range
1BR $2,250 $1,180 - $2,450
2BR $1,700 $1,450 - $2,800
3BR $1,800 $1,450 - $2,650
4+BR $3,780 $3,780 - $3,780

Methodology

Each month, using over 1 million Rentable listings across the United States, we calculate the median 1-bedroom and 2-bedroom rent prices by city, state, and nation, and track the month-over-month percent change. To avoid small sample sizes, we restrict the analysis for our reports to cities meeting minimum population and property count thresholds.
